Ce este RGS și rolul său în ecosistem
Articol complet
1) Definiția și locul în peisaj
RGS (Remote Game Server) este un server de jocuri de studio de la distanță. El este:- stochează matematica jocului (logica RNG, tabelele de plată, stările rotunde);
- generează rezultate (câștig/pierdere, multiplicatori, freespins, runde bonus);
- oferă activelor clienților (uneori prin CDN) și servește sesiuni;
- comunică cu platforma/agregatorul printr-o serie de API/webhook-uri pentru a scrie pariul, a credita câștigurile, a aplica restricții, a participa la jackpot-uri, misiuni etc.
Dacă platforma este „bancară și contabilă”, atunci RGS este o „uzină de jocuri”: el este cel care produce rezultatele.
2) Ce tipuri de conținut servește RGS
Sloturi RNG (clasic, Megaways/Cluster/Lines, Bonus Buy, Hold & Win, etc.).
Jocuri instant (accident, mină, roți, zgârieturi, zaruri) - dacă este necesar cu module „dovedabil corecte”.
Tabelul RNG (măsură blackjack/bandă fără video live).
Jackpot-uri (adesea un sub-server Jackpot/RJP separat, dar împreună cu RGS).
3) Principalele responsabilități ale RGS
1. Matematică și integritate: punerea în aplicare a regulilor certificate, RNG valabile și managementul sid.
2. Managementul rundei: start/progres/finalizare, stări bonus (freespins, mai multe etape).
3. Apeluri financiare: operațiuni idempotente de debitare/creditare (prin intermediul unei platforme sau al unui portofel direct).
4. Limite și RG-uri: limita maximă de miză/câștig, blocuri de jurisdicție, file de turneu/bonus.
5. Jackpot-uri și promo-uri: contribuții, declanșatoare, misiuni/realizări, quest-uri.
6. Telemetrie și raportare: evenimente pentru BI și autoritățile de reglementare, jurnale de audit, semnale anticorore/antifraudă.
7. Livrare conținut: versiuni de active, limbi/valute, rezervă și migrații.
4) Cum RGS vorbește cu platforma: model API
Cel mai adesea - server-to-server exchange + client front (WebGL/HTML5) pentru jucător.
4. 1 Criterii finale de bază (schemă condiţională)
„POST/session/create” - emiterea unui token ținând cont de geo/valută/joc.
'POST/bet/authorize' - solicitarea de a anula pariul (de la 'idempotency _ key').
'POST/bet/settle' - returnează rezultatul rundei și cere ca câștigul să fie creditat.
„POST/bonus/stat” - eliberare gratuită/ardere, progresul pariului.
4. 2 Cârlige web RGS→platforma
Cerințe cheie: idempotență, semnături de cerere (HMAC/EdDSA), răspunsuri SLA scurte (p95 <300-500 ms pe căi critice), eroare clară și coduri repetate.
5) Bani: unde este „adevărul” și cum să evitați ia
Sursa adevărului în balanță este portofelul platformei. RGS nu păstrează banii, păstrează statutul rotund.
Toate tranzacțiile monetare cu 'Idempotency-Key' și strict unice 'bet _ id'/' round _ id'.
Sagas/compensații: dacă după rezultat conexiunea cu platforma a scăzut - RGS deține rezultatul și se retrage la un succes 'wallet. credit ".
Rollback-contur: un collback al platformei poate iniția un rollback prin 'bet _ id' (strict conform regulilor).
6) Jackpot-uri și mecanică promoțională
Portofelul Jackpot (local/online) ia un depozit micro din pariu; declanșator - prin logica sid sau probabilistică.
Strat promoțional: misiuni, multiplicatori ai zilei, evenimente sezoniere, bilete „turneu” - vândute pe RGS sau într-un Serviciu Promo separat abonat la evenimentele jocului.
Participarea la promo nu ar trebui să schimbe RTP a nucleului matematic al jocului (în caz contrar, este necesară o nouă certificare).
7) Certificare și conformitate (generală)
RNG/Math: Auditul meselor de joc, gama RTP, variația, aleatoriu.
Colectarea evenimentelor pentru autoritatea de reglementare (busteni rata/rezultat, versiuni client, control integritate).
Geo-profiluri: funcții on/off, limite, valute, unități de pariere/câștigătoare.
Versioning: Orice schimbare de matematică - versiune nouă și recertificare.
8) Arhitectura RGS: în interiorul serverului
Straturi:1. API gateway (mTLS/WAF/limitare, semnături).
2. Session & Auth (jetoane JWT/opace, dispozitive/verificări geo).
3. Game Engine (miez de matematică, stări de runde).
4. Promo/Jackpot Conector (nu interferează cu matematica, doar evenimente).
5. Integrare (portofel/platformă/agregator, retrai, eliminare a duplicatelor).
6. Telemetrie și audit (evenimente de autobuz, rapoarte, jurnal WORM de acțiuni crete).
7. Active/CDN (versiuni, limbi, canale de testare/luptă).
Date:- OLTP pentru sesiuni/runde (p95 <150 ms);
- Cache (Redis) pentru stări și limite fierbinți;
- Flux de evenimente asincrone (Kafka/analog) → DWH/BI;
- PII și izolarea cheie pe regiuni (rezidență de date).
9) Performanță și fiabilitate
Latență: țintă p95 <150-200 ms pe „pariu/decontare” (fără hamei de plată).
Scalare orizontală: starea jocului este minimă, sesiuni lipicioase prin 'session _ id' sau complet apatrid + stocare externă.
Back-pressure: cozi pentru emiterea rezultatelor, protecție împotriva „furtunilor de pariuri”.
Practici de haos: emularea picăturilor de platformă/agregator, verificarea sagas/retras.
DR-plan: activ-activ pe regiuni, RPO ≤ 5 min, RTO ≤ 30 min.
10) Securitate „implicit”
mTLS + HMAC/EdDSA la nivel de integrare, jetoane de scurtă durată.
RBAC/ABAC în panoul de admin studio, „patru ochi” pe schimbarea matematica/limite.
Secrete în seif/HSM; criptarea în repaus/în tranzit; tokenizarea câmpurilor sensibile.
Antibot/antiabuză: reguli de viteză, jurnale de frecvență intrare/pariu, amprentare dispozitiv.
Auditul WORM al acțiunilor critice și al versiunilor de construcție.
11) Rolul agregatorului și opțiunile de conectivitate
Agregatorul oferă o singură interfață la zeci de RGS: catalog de jocuri, API unificat, rutare, raportare, acces la piață (recenzii rapide/mărci).
Conectarea directă la platformă oferă mai puține „hamei” și control, dar mai scumpe în integrări și certificare pentru fiecare piață.
Compromis: printr-un agregator pentru distribuția pe scară largă și integrarea directă a operatorilor strategici.
12) Cazuri speciale
Crash/Provably fair: publicarea semințelor/sării ascunse, hash verificat de client; sincronizarea rezultatelor cu partea serverului.
Bonus Buy/Feature Drop: Finanțe - Atomic; limitele jurisdicționale (nu sunt permise peste tot).
RTP/piscine adaptive (dacă este permis): comutarea profilurilor numai într-un interval certificat; jurnal de schimbare.
Runde gratuite (conduse de operator): Biletele Frispin sunt validate de RGS, dar portofelul este pe platformă.
13) Ce contează pentru studio atunci când își construiesc propriul RGS
Lista de verificare:- Miezul jocului este separat de straturile de rețea (testăm desktop/CI).
- Idempotency 'bet/settle/rollback', chei rotunde unice.
- Sagas, retroacere backoff, deduplicare broker/bază de date.
- Versionarea matematicii/activelor; migrații de stat fără timpi morți.
- Event bus și directoare de date, câmpuri pentru BI/regulator.
- cârlige RG și geo-politicieni; „kill-switch” în caracteristică.
- Observabilitate: p95/p99, eroare-rate, settle-lag, pariuri/min, măsurători de latență jackpot.
- Exerciții DR/xaoc, teste de sarcină și cutii de nisip de integrare.
- Securitate: Vault/HSM, rotație cheie, semnături, WAF, limite, anti-boți.
- Documentație API (specificații + exemple) și SDK pentru platforme/agregatoare.
14) Ce este esențial pentru platformă/operator atunci când alegeți RGS
Onestitatea și stabilitatea matematicii (istoricul certificării, intervalele RTP, toleranța la erori).
SLA/telemetrie (tablouri de bord reale, alerte, timp de răspuns suport).
Profiluri regionale (valute, texte, rezidențe de date, respectarea normelor locale).
Compatibilitate cu bonusuri/turnee (contribuție după tip de joc, pariu maxim, anti-abuz).
Integrarea jackpot-ului (portofele transparente, rapoarte).
Excepții și incidente (protocoale rollback, companie, postmortems publice pentru eșecuri majore).
15) Mini glosar
RGS este un server de joc studio care generează rezultate de joc RNG.
PAM este o platformă de gestionare a jucătorilor (conturi/sesiuni).
Registru/Portofel - contabilitate de numerar de la operator (adevărat în bilanț).
Agregator este un intermediar care combină multe RGS sub un singur API.
RTP/Volatilitate/Hit-Rate - parametrii matematică slot.
Saga/Outbox/CDC - modele de livrare consecvență și eveniment.
Dovably Fair - onestitate testată de jucători (crash/instantanee).
Jurnalul WORM - jurnal neschimbabil pentru audit.
RGS este unitatea de producție iGaming lui. Acesta întruchipează matematica jocului, oferă onestitate și viteza de runde, conectează jackpot-uri și promo-uri, și prin API-uri de încredere conectează conținut de studio cu platforme și agregatoare din întreaga lume. RGS puternic este construit pe idempotence, eventfulness, securitate strictă și certificare. Această fundație vă permite să lansați jocuri mai repede, să scalați traficul fără a pierde bani și să îndepliniți cerințele oricărei jurisdicții mature.
